(specifically the Bloodborne Asset Tools ecosystem) functions as an unpacker and decryptor for data archives. Because titles like Bloodborne store data inside closed, compressed containers, standalone asset extraction requires a primary software layer to translate proprietary game archives into standard, individual files ( .flver , .tpf ). Game models are typically compressed inside .dcx or .bnd archives within the game's parts or chr directories.
